Recipe: Creamy Avocado-Lime Wasabi

This recipe is designed for speed and impact, creating a culinary masterpiece in under five minutes.

Yields: Approx. ½ cup

Prep time: 5 minutes

Ingredients:

  • 1 ripe medium avocado, halved and pitted
  • 1 ½ teaspoons high-quality wasabi paste (or start with 1 tsp of wasabi powder mixed with 1 tsp of water)
  • 1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
  • ½ teaspoon soy sauce or tamari (optional, for umami depth)
  • A pinch of sea salt

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Wasabi: If using wasabi powder, mix it with an equal amount of water to form a thick paste. Let it sit for about 5 minutes to allow its flavor to develop and become more potent.
  2. Combine Ingredients: Scoop the avocado flesh into a small bowl. Add the prepared wasabi paste, fresh lime juice, soy sauce (if using), and a pinch of salt.
  3. Mash to Perfection: Using a fork, mash all the ingredients together until you achieve a smooth, creamy, and velvety consistency. For an ultra-smooth texture, you can use a small food processor or an immersion blender.
  4. Taste and Refine: Taste the mixture. If you desire more heat, add wasabi in small ¼ teaspoon increments until it reaches your preferred level of spiciness.
  5. Serve: Transfer the creamy wasabi to a serving dish. To prevent browning if you're not serving it immediately, press a piece of plastic wrap directly onto the surface of the sauce and refrigerate.

Why This Recipe Will Change Your Life

This isn't just wasabi; it's a multi-purpose flavor bomb. The creamy texture and balanced heat make it incredibly versatile.

  • Elevate Your Sushi Night: Say goodbye to mixing paste into soy sauce. A dollop of this cream directly on your nigiri or roll enhances the flavor of the fish without overwhelming it.
  • The Ultimate Sauce for Meats and Fish: It's a phenomenal partner for grilled steak, seared tuna, or baked salmon. The zesty cream cuts through the richness of the meat and fish beautifully.
  • A Gourmet Sandwich Spread: Transform a simple turkey or chicken sandwich into a foodie's dream.
  • An Unforgettable Dip: Serve it with vegetable sticks, crackers, or even sweet potato fries for an appetizer that will have everyone talking.
